Our multipolar overhead contact line is a special power supply system for use with three-phase AC railways. In contrast to conventional three-phase applications, where each of the three phases is routed through separate conductors, this system uses a two-pole overhead contact line and utilises the running rails as conductors for the third phase. This arrangement calls for accurate planning and execution, especially in the area around turnouts, where the parallel running of two overhead contact lines and pantographs requires complex technical solutions. Our multipolar overhead contact line is currently being used in prestigious projects such as the Jungfrau Railway in the Bernese Oberland and the Gornergrat Railway in Valais. The extreme climatic conditions in these regions, including significant temperature fluctuations and the resulting changes in altitude of the contact wire, place special demands on the components. To overcome these specific challenges, we have developed an automatically tensioned version of the multipolar overhead contact line that offers high reliability under variable environmental conditions.
